Ithorian mist is by FAR the best xp for the resources used, however it's a pain getting the corn/wheat/water unless you can plant down three high level harvesters and afford them.


When I have corn and wheat I grind mist. When I don't I grind stewed gwouch because water and ANY type of organic is always available.

This brings up a good point. If you have one heavy flora harvester and one heavy water harvester then is Ithorian Mist really the best thing for you to grind? I say no.


Ithorian mist nets 178 xp per item at a cost of 60 organics and 20 water.


Stewed gwouch nets 105 per item at a cost of 25 organics and 20 water.


So if water isn't a big deal to you then (like myself) you'll probably find grinding the gwouch is better. It's just double the clicks and you'll need to tape up your wrists.
